description Product Description
Used primarily in research settings as a selective antagonist for adenosine receptors, particularly the A1 subtype. This property makes it valuable in studies related to cardiovascular function, neurotransmission, and renal physiology. It helps investigate the role of adenosine in modulating heart rate, blood pressure, and ischemic preconditioning.
Also employed in neurological research to explore adenosine's involvement in sleep regulation, seizures, and neuroprotection. Due to its ability to cross the blood-brain barrier, it is useful in central nervous system studies.
Not used clinically but serves as a tool compound in pharmacological and physiological experiments.
